Product introduction

Calcium is a metal element, which is a silver-white crystal at room temperature. Animal bones, clam shells and egg shells all contain calcium carbonate. The detection of calcium content in living organisms is mainly achieved by detecting the concentration of calcium ions. At present, the commonly used dyes include o-cresolphthalide complex ketone (OCPC), azo arsenic Ⅲ, methyl thymol blue (MTB), etc.

In this kit, calcium ions in solution can combine with MTB under alkaline conditions to form a sea blue/blue complex. Magnesium ion chelator was added to remove magnesium ion background interference. The absorbance at 610nm was detected by spectrophotometer, and the total calcium content was calculated according to the formula.
